Common case for such situations is a call to an object that was released due to low memory warnings. EXEC_BAD_ACCESS — accessing to over-release object according to Apple's source (http://developer.apple.com/library/mac/#qa/qa1367/) You can find an actual source of the problem by taking a crash logs from your device and symbolizing it to an actual code strings in your product. I assume that knowing the class and method and code line number will give you a preliminary understanding what goes wrong in your code. Please, review following apple's article to understand further details — http://developer.apple.com/library/ios/#technotes/tn2151/_index.html
For an advanced topics on debugging following link maybe also very useful — http://developer.apple.com/library/ios/#technotes/tn2239/_index.html Actually Apple provides a ton of difference ways to debug such type of an issue.

If it is indeed caused by a memory hit, you can try running it on the simulator, which has a menu item which lets you send your app a simulated memory warning. Your app will try to do all the things it does during a real memory warning, and that might help you find your bug. Also, look at running with NSZombies enabled You might want to check out this page -- I find it very helpful:

I had a crash from this API too. I was allowing my tableView to copy cells which displays a context copy menu automatically.
The crash was the result of a user clicking the back button of the navigation bar instead of clicking this menu option. The menu doesn't get dismissed and stays floating on the window until someone taps it. By this time the UITableViewController subclass is popped off the navigation stack resulting in a message being sent to the deallocated instance.
This might be an Apple UIKit bug, I'm not sure. One solution is to dismiss the menu manually in your viewWillDisappear: method.
- (void)viewWillDisappear:(BOOL)animated
{
[super viewWillDisappear:animated];
[[UIMenuController sharedMenuController] setMenuVisible:NO animated:animated];
}

Finally after a few more hours of frustrating experiments I found the solution. The whole thing hadn't to anything with the second target. The Problem was the NSURLConnectionDelegate. In this class I implemented a Property named appID. And in one of the methods of the class, I set the variable without the setter. So I placed an autoreleased object at the position of a property. This one get released and the pointer to the variable gets invalid. As soon as the Delegate was released, a Method was sent to this yet released object.

You must be dereferencing a NULL pointer, other than this crash does not happen. The Static Analyzer is a nice tool for getting hints on things you're doing wrong. However, it not finding an error does not mean that your program is bug-free. Also turning on zombies does not always help. Sometimes it's just a simple little oversight.
The fact the simulator does not show this problem doesn't say too much. In the end it's a different machine with a different processor and a different architecture. There are occasions where false code runs well on one platform but crashes on the other.
You should re-symbolicate you stack trace and have a close look at that function it's crashing in. If you want more help it's probably best to post some of the code here.
One more hint: these issues are often spread over multiple methods. The analyzer only sees one method at a time. You should have a look at what happened to the objects in your crashing method BEFORE it was entered.

If you're storing the actual URL to a file in the app's directory instead of regenerating it each time relative to the app directory, then the invalid URL is the result of the simulator/device changing the name of the app directory to a random UUID. It does that sometimes in response to crashes.
The obvious first step is the log the URL and see if the store is actually at that location.
Drew,
Without seeing some code, I can tell you that one source of agony to me when I first started with Core Data was versioning your models. If you have changed your managed object model in any way, this will cause your app to crash without some versioning (i.e., lightweight) code in place.
This may not be the source of your problem, but one thing you can try is to either remove your app from your iPhone Simulator or use "Reset Contents and Settings" from the iPhone simulator menu. If this fixes the problem, then you're looking at a migrations issue.
